LACBA leaders to meet, debate financial future
Paul L. Kiesel, president of the Los Angeles County Bar Association, has been invited by the group’s law practice section leaders to meet Wednesday to discuss concerns over how association funds have been spent.

After months of uproar at the Los Angeles County Bar Association over how to return the nonprofit to a strong financial footing, a group of 15 law practice sections have invited the Board of Trustees to a meeting at the Los Angeles Athletic Club Wednesday to discuss concerns over how funds have been spent and reported over the past decade.
